PUBLIC NOTIFICATION OF AN APPLICATION MADE UNDER REGULATION 10 OF THE POLLUTION AND CONTROL (ENGLAND AND WALES) REGULATIONS 2000
INTEGRATED POLLUTION PREVENTION AND CONTROL

Notice is hereby given that Grampian Country Chickens (Rearing) Ltd, has applied to the Environmental Agency for an Integrated Pollution Prevention and Control (IPPC) permit to operate an installation involving the rearing of broiler birds for meat production. The installation is located off Clay Lane, Burtonwood, Warrington, in the district of Warrington Borough Council in the county of Cheshire.
The application contains a description of any foreseeable significant effects of emissions from the installation on the environment.
Information relating to the above IPPC application for a permit to operate Warrington Farm, is held in registers at the following locations:

The Environment Agency, Appleton House, 430 Birchwood Boulevard, Birchwood, Warrington WA3 7WD and Warrington Borough Council, Palmyra House, Palmyra Square North, Warrington WA1 1JN.

Members of the public can inspect these registers, free of charge, at the above-stated addresses during normal office hours. In addition, members of the public who wish to obtain a copy of the relevant information contained in the registers can do so upon the payment of a reasonable charge to cover the costs of copying.
Any objections or representations to the above IPPC application should be made in writing to the Environment Agency, Appleton House, 430 Birchwood Boulevard, Birchwood, Warrington WA3 7WD, within 28 days from the date of this public notice.
Any such objections or representations will be entered into a public register unless the person making them requests in writing that they should not be so placed. If there is such a request, the register will only include a statement that there has been a request.
